Guest User

Untitled

a guest
Jan 22nd, 2018
56
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.97 KB | None | 0 0
  1. <ul class="menu menu_sub menu_mega">
  2. <?$previousLevel = 0;
  3. foreach ($arResult['CATALOG_SECTIONS'] as $k => $c) {
  4. if ($previousLevel && $c[3]["DEPTH_LEVEL"] < $previousLevel){
  5. echo str_repeat("</ul></li>", ($previousLevel - $arItem["DEPTH_LEVEL"]));
  6. }
  7. if($c[3]['IS_PARENT']){
  8. if($c[3]['DEPTH_LEVEL'] == 1){?>
  9. <li class="menu__item"><span class="title"><a href="<?=$c[1]?>"><?=$c[0]?></a></span>
  10. <ul class="menu">
  11. <?}else{?>
  12.  
  13. <li class="menu__item"><a href="<?=$c[1]?>" class="menu__link"><?=$c[0]?></a></li>
  14. <?}?>
  15. <?}else{?>
  16. <?if($c[3]['DEPTH_LEVEL'] == 1){?>
  17. <li class="menu__item"><span class="title"><a href="<?=$c[1]?>"><?=$c[0]?></a></span>
  18. <?}else{?>
  19. <li class="menu__item"><a href="<?=$c[1]?>" class="menu__link"><?=$c[0]?></a></li>
  20. <?}?>
  21. <?}?>
  22. <?$previousLevel = $c[3]["DEPTH_LEVEL"];?>
  23. <?}?>
  24. <?if ($previousLevel > 1)://close last item tags?>
  25. <?=str_repeat("</ul></li>", ($previousLevel-1) );?>
  26. <?endif?>
  27. </ul>
Add Comment
Please, Sign In to add comment